The designs, wrote Pamela Haag for Zócalo Public Squarein 2016, were Winchester’s she sketched them onto napkins or pieces of brown paper, then handed them over to a team of carpenters. The construction project continued until Winchester’s death in 1922, producing an enormous, labyrinthine mansion filled with logic-defying features: staircases that end at the ceiling, indoor balconies, skylights built into floors, doors that open onto walls. In San Jose, she purchased an eight-room farmhouse that she began to renovate in 1886. Winchester decided to leave her home in New Haven, Connecticut, and head to California, where two of her sisters lived. This staircase in the Winchester Mystery House leads to the ceiling. Her husband, William Wirt Winchester, died in 1881, leaving his widow with a vast fortune: 50 percent ownership in the Repeating Arms Company and a $20 million inheritance. Four years later, she gave birth to a daughter, Annie, who died about a month later. Sarah Lockwood Pardee married into the Winchester family in 1862. The narrated video tour spans more than 40 minutes, providing insight into the property and the mysterious woman who built it: Sarah Winchester, wealthy and reclusive heiress to the Winchester Repeating Arms Company, which manufactured an innovative rifle that became a fixture of Westward expansion. Select Bookmarks → Toggle Bookmarks ( Strg+B). ![]() ![]() ![]() This retrospective study included 15 eyes of 15 patients, eleven males and four females, with a diagnosis of pellucid marginal degeneration (PMD) in whom MyoRing was implanted using the PocketMaker Microkeratome for PMD correction at Bina eye hospital, Tehran, Iran, between October 2012 and November 2013. The use of the MyoRing implantation has proven safe and effective in patients with high myopia, post LASIK ectasia, and keratoconus ( 25- 32). The MyoRing (Dioptex GmbH) is a 360º continuous intracorneal ring that is implanted into the cornea using the PocketMaker Microkeratome or femtosecond laser. Due to the unsatisfactory results of the available treatments for PMD, the use of intracorneal ring segments (ICRS) has been proposed, in order to improve visual outcomes ( 18- 24). However, all of these techniques are irreversible which require a long period of rehabilitation with unpredictable visual results ( 13- 17). ![]() In patients who cannot tolerate contact lenses or in those who do not achieve adequate visual acuity with contact lenses because of the degree of ectasia, several surgical procedures including penetrating keratoplasty, deep anterior lamellar keratoplasty, crescentic wedge resection, thermokeratoplasty, epikeratoplasty, and crescentic lamellar keratoplasty, have been proposed. Patients with high or irregular astigmatism cannot be corrected with spectacles in these cases, contact lens fitting is more difficult in pellucid eyes than keratoconic eyes as a result of central flattening and peripheral steepening ( 9- 12). The non-surgical management of PMD includes spectacles and different groups of contact lenses ( 6- 8), yet these procedures lose their effectiveness as the disease progresses. The management of PMD depends on the severity of the disease. Visual symptoms include long-standing poor visual acuity, which results from high irregular against-the-rule astigmatism ( 2- 5). The topographic appearance is a classical “butterfly” pattern demonstrating a large amount of against-the-rule astigmatism that makes the fitting of contact lenses difficult. The gold standard diagnostic test for PMD is corneal topography. The area of thinning is typically around 1 or 2 mm in width, which extends from 4 to 8-o’clock positions ( 1- 4). Pellucid marginal corneal degeneration (PMD) is a rare, non-inflammatory ectatic disorder of the inferior peripheral cornea characterized by a crescent-shaped band of inferior corneal thinning. ![]() ![]() ![]() When creating customizable invitations with Paperless Post, you can ask guests questions to gather more information about dietary needs and other preferences. The basic process is normally described as something like this:ĭecide what you're going to do. Over the past few decades, the technique has become more popular. Since the Italian for tomato is "pomodoro," he called his system the Pomodoro Technique after the original little tomato timer. And it helped-he was instantly more productive, at least when the timer was running.Īfter a bit of tweaking, testing, and refining, Cirillo settled on 25 minutes of work followed by a five-minute break, repeated four times, as the best balance for him. Cirillo started by setting it for 10 minutes and trying to just work for the 10 minutes until the timer rang. Inspiration came from a small tomato-shaped kitchen timer. He kept getting distracted and losing focus (and he didn't even have Instagram or TikTok), so he went looking for a way to keep his mind on track. Even I can keep typing that long.įrancesco Cirillo developed the Pomodoro Technique in the 1980s when he was in college in Italy and struggling to study.
